The Magic of Natural Light in the English Countryside

The weather in the United Kingdom is famous for its unpredictability, but for a fine art destination wedding photography approach, this unpredictability is an asset. The soft, overcast skies of the Cotswolds act as a massive, natural softbox. This particular light refines skin tones, eliminates harsh shadows, and brings out the deep, painterly textures of historic stone and manicured gardens.

When you look at timeless film-inspired wedding photography, the imagery carries a distinct, nostalgic quality that digital precision often misses. This look is achieved by working with the organic atmosphere rather than fighting it. Whether it is the golden hour hitting the ivy-covered walls of a manor or a misty morning before the ceremony, the countryside provides a cinematic canvas that feels profoundly honest.

Choosing the Right Venue for Editorial Documentary Wedding Photography

The venue sets the structural rhythm for the entire visual narrative. For sophisticated couples seeking an understated yet grand celebration, the historic estates in and around the Cotswolds and Wiltshire offer unparalleled architecture. Venues like the iconic, Italianate terraces of Euridge Manor or the grand heritage of historic country houses blur the line between classic British legacy and global luxury.

When selecting a location, look for spaces that allow your documentation to breathe. Great editorial wedding photography relies on movement, scale, and natural frames. Expansive lawns, hidden walled gardens, and historic orangeries allow guests to mingle naturally, creating genuine opportunities to capture spontaneous, unposed emotions without human interference.

Balancing Fine Art Aesthetic with Candid Documentation

An international luxury wedding should never feel like a forced, multi-hour fashion shoot. The modern approach to high-end imagery relies on working silently to capture moments you will remember forever. It is about balancing the intentional composition of fine art portraiture with the raw, uninterrupted truth of a documentary method.

This means documenting the quiet, solitary moments before the bride steps into the aisle, the shared glance between families, and the unfiltered energy of the evening celebration. By blending an editorial artistic eye with a commitment to capturing real-time emotion, the resulting wedding gallery becomes a collection of heirloom artwork rather than just a checklist of standard photographs.
